Job Description

Toms Holidays require Housekeeping staff, both Cleaners and Supervisors, for Friday/Saturday changeovers at Riviere Towans, Hayle in a non-customer facing environment.

Working hours normally between – 8:00am to 4:00pm

Salary: £10.50 – £12.50 per hour

Experience an advantage. Ability to clean and prepare properties to a high standard with attention to detail. As well as your pay, you will receive all necessary training, holiday pay and uniform.

Working either on your own or in a small team, you will be responsible for preparing properties to meet the high standards and expectations of our guests but there will always be a supervisor to call on if you have any questions.

We have written cleaning protocols and training to ensure the safety of all. We supply cleaning products and PPE as advised by Visit Cornwall and PASC. 

Join our busy, cheerful team, giving our guests the best possible long awaited holiday. We look forward to seeing you.

Job Types: Part-time, Temporary

COVID-19 considerations: Full PPE, training and Protocols in place.
